Job Description:

We are seeking a Global Supply Manager (GSM) to lead sourcing and supplier strategy for IT infrastructure and technology services that enable scalable, secure, and reliable operations at 1X. This role is part of a team-based infrastructure sourcing organization, where category ownership is intentionally split across multiple Global Supply Managers based on experience and business needs.

Job Responsibility:

  • Develop and execute sourcing strategies for assigned IT infrastructure and technology categories
  • Lead RFx processes, supplier selection, negotiations, and contract execution
  • Build and manage supplier relationships aligned to performance, cost, and scalability needs
  • Partner closely with IT, Security, Engineering, Operations, Legal, and Finance
  • Support site IT buildouts, infrastructure scaling, and technology programs
  • Drive cost optimization, supplier performance, and risk mitigation
  • Monitor supplier KPIs and ensure compliance with commercial agreements

Requirements:

  • 5+ years of experience in global supply management, strategic sourcing, procurement, or supply chain
  • Demonstrated depth in IT infrastructure and/or technology services sourcing (e.g., networking, data center, managed services, cloud-adjacent services)
  • Experience sourcing and negotiating services-based agreements, including SLAs, SOWs, and commercial terms
  • Proven ability to own sourcing end-to-end (strategy, supplier selection, negotiation, and contract execution)
  • Strong commercial and negotiation skills, particularly in vendor and services environments
  • Experience partnering with IT, Security, Engineering, and Operations stakeholders
  • Comfort operating in fast-paced, ambiguous, startup-style environments

Nice to have:

  • Experience sourcing managed IT services or network services
  • Familiarity with vendor performance management and SLA enforcement
  • Experience supporting multi-site or global IT infrastructure
